Output 9bcfdcfafbb1386de88b32d3c33c5d5498799d07ebcee00b63149e8d57cfeebf:0

value
10306
script pubkey
OP_0 OP_PUSHBYTES_20 5084a7a09af88a33760aa1660f15c8e7144d2981
address
bc1q2zz20gy6lz9rxas259nq79wguu2y62vptd289d
transaction
9bcfdcfafbb1386de88b32d3c33c5d5498799d07ebcee00b63149e8d57cfeebf
confirmations
346515
spent
true